La Porte Man a Wrigley Post Season Fixture

(La Porte, IN) - A La Porte man was back at Wrigley Field Wednesday night for Game 3 in the playoffs between the Chicago Cubs and Milwaukee Brewers.

 

Dave Pendergast was also there with his wife, Rhonda, when the Cubs facing elimination held on to win 4 to 3.

 

“It was a fabulous game. It was a very, very, very fun evening,” Pendergast said.

 

The longtime Cubs season ticket holder also has tickets for the entire post season and went to the two previous playoff games at Wrigley Field against the San Diego Padres.

 

Pendergast, a retired financial advisor, was at Wrigley Field during the post season in 2016 when the Cubs won the World Series for the first time in over 100 years.  He said the Cubs winning the remaining games to advance won’t be easy, but like most Cubs fans, he is optimistic.

 

If the Cubs tie the series Thursday night, the deciding game will be played on Saturday in Milwaukee.

 

Pendergast, who once served on the La Porte City Council, is currently a member of the La Porte Park Foundation Board.
